Originally posted by nasty1:


I should be able to get the waterpump and waterpump belt from autozone or something, simply by asking and giving my car information.





Yep, open the box to make sure it is really a white plastic or metal impeller before you pay for it. In addition, I have read in previous posts that some have had problems with Kelly belts but they usually stock Dayco belts (so you should be fine).

Edit. Parts

Napa (554091 with gasket or 1251910 w/o) or Autozone. Pretty much the same price about $70.

Don't forget the gasket too about $3(if WP does not come with one).

And you would want a new WP belt (about $12). Dayco 5030268.
